Fox Hunt Hollow
Fox Hunt Hollow is a valley in Fayette, Illinois and has an elevation of 528 feet. Fox Hunt Hollow is situated nearby to the village Ramsey, as well as near the hamlet Bayle City.Places of Interest

Ramsey Lake State Recreation Area
Nature reserve
Ramsey Lake State Recreation Area is a 1,980-acre state park located in Fayette County, Illinois, United States. The nearest town is Ramsey, Illinois, and the park is adjacent to U.S. Highway 51.

Ramsey
Village
Ramsey is a village in Fayette County, Illinois, United States. The population was 911 as of the 2020 census. The village was named after Alexander Ramsey, an American politician, second governor of Minnesota. Ramsey is situated 2 miles east of Fox Hunt Hollow.
